prostatitis- An umbrella term for a group of diseases of acute or chronic inflammation of the prostate. Stress, lack of exercise (sedentary, lack of exercise), bacterial infections are the main causes of prostatitis, but not the only ones. It is important to correctly identify the type of prostatitis and its cause - 90% of treatment success depends on this and how quickly a man recovers. Acute prostatitis requires urgent medical attention. If the disease is caused by a stagnant process in the prostate tissue (a sedentary lifestyle, irregular sex), this type of prostatitis can be treated at home. However, we again stress that none of the activities we will consider in this article will replace the competent advice of the urologist's personal choice, they will only improve the quality of life. It is important to distinguish between prostatitis and prostatitisprostate adenomaThese diseases are often confused. If prostatitis is based on an inflammatory process, then prostatic adenoma is a benign prostatic hyperplasia that mainly results in urinary disturbances.

External prostate massage is not as effective as rectal massage, however, if done correctly and regularly, it will help reduce stagnant processes in the tissues and improve blood circulation.

Massage is performed manually with gentle circular movements without intense pressure. Also, you can use a special massager or roll a tennis ball for 20-30 minutes.

In order for a home massage with prostatitis to have beneficial effects without causing harm, it is important to know the location of the prostate and be sure to take into accountContraindications!

Prostate massage should not be performed in the following situations:

  • acute prostatitis;
  • signs of malignant processes;
  • Cysts and stones are present in the prostate.

Beforehand, you can consult a urologist.

Pills for Prostatitis

It's important to consider all of these recommendations in conjunction with the treatments your doctor prescribes, including medications. For example, standard treatment regimens for chronic bacterial prostatitis include antibiotics, non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s, and sometimes antidepressants.
